Space-saving Dual Output Signal Conditioners
Mini-MW Series
PULSE ISOLATOR
Functions & Features
• Galvanically isolates pulse rate signals
• Input frequency = output frequency
• Various outputs (open collector, voltage pulses and dry contact AC/DC switch)
• High-density mounting
Typical Applications
• Isolating field pulse signals in order to reduce noises
• Changing e.g. dry contact signal to e.g. 5 V signals

GENERAL SPECIFICATIONS
Construction
: Plug-in
Connection
: M3 screw terminals (torque 0.8 N·m)
Screw terminal
: Chromated steel (standard) or stainless steel
Housing material
: Flame-resistant resin (black)
Isolation
: Input to output 1 to output 2 to power
Frequency range
: Input and output are the same.
Chattering protection
: Filter provided for mechanical contact input
Input pulse sensing
: DC coupled
INPUT SPECIFICATIONS
Excitation
: 12 V DC @30 mA; shortcircuit protection
■
Open Collector
Maximum frequency
: 10 kHz
Pulse width time requirement
: 10 μsec. min. for ON and OFF
Sensing
: Approx. 12 V DC @3 mA
ON/OFF level
: ≤ 600 Ω / 1.8 V for ON, ≥ 100 kΩ / 3.5 V for OFF
■
Mechanical Contact
Maximum frequency
: 30 Hz
Pulse width time requirement
: 10 msec. min. for ON and OFF
Sensing
: Approx. 12 V DC @3 mA
ON/OFF level
: ≤ 200 Ω / 0.6 V for ON, ≥ 100 kΩ / 2.5 V for OFF
■
Voltage Pulse
Maximum frequency
: 10 kHz
Pulse width time requirement
: 10 μsec. min. for high and low levels
Waveforms
: Square or sine
Hi/Lo level
: 2 – 50 V DC for high level; ≤1 V DC for low level
Input impedance
: 10 kΩ min.
■
Clamp-on Pulse Sensor CLSP
Maximum frequency
: 50 000 pulses/hour
ON/OFF level
: ≤ 400 Ω / 1.3 V for ON, ≥ 200 kΩ / 12 V for OFF
